Girish Puthenchery
Gireesh Puthenchery [1961-2010] was a noted Malayalam lyricist and Screen play writer. He also served as a governing council member of the Indian Performance Rights Society (IPRS). He was born to Pulikkal Krishna Panicker and Meenakshiyamma in Puthenchery near Ulliyeri village in Kozhikode district. His father was an Astrologer-Ayurvedic practitioner and his mother was a Carnatic musician.
He suffered a brain haemorrhage and died at a private hospital on Wednesday Feb 10,2010 (aged 48). He was survived by his wife Beena and children Jithin Krishnan (Engineering student) and Dinanath (Plus Two student).
Besides writing lyrics for several hit songs, Girish had also written the script for the films Melepparambil Aanveedu, Vadakkunnathan and Pallavoor Devanarayanan. He was scripting a film by the name of Raman Police in which Mohanlal was expected to play the lead role.
Beginning his career in the 1989 film "Enquiry", Girish went on to write lyrics for about 1556 songs in about 328 Malayalam films. His first popular hit songs were from the movie Johny Walker. Happy Husbands released on January 14, 2010 was his last film.

Awards
Kerala State Film Awards:
2004 - Best Lyricist - Kathavasheshan
2003 - Best Lyricist - Gourisankaram
2002 - Best Lyricist - Nandanam
2001 - Best Lyricist - Ravanaprabhu
1999 - Best Lyricist - Punaradivasam
1997 - Best Lyricist - Krishnagudiyil Oru Pranayakalathu
1995 - Best Lyricist - Agnidevan
Asianet Film Awards
2008 - Best Lyricist Award -Madambi
2006 - Best Lyricist Award -Vadakumnadhan
2004 - Best Lyricist Award -Mambazhakalam
